U.S. Rep. Mo Brooks released video footage from a home security camera that appears to show a process server entering the garage at the congressman’s Huntsville residence to serve a lawsuit to his wife on Sunday.
Meanwhile, Brooks said Monday night he had been served with the lawsuit while in Saks near Anniston while campaigning for U.S. Senate.
Brooks and his wife, Martha, filed an incident report with Huntsville police for criminal trespassing following the Sunday incident.
